TL;DR Summary

A United Airlines Boeing 787-9 bound for New Jersey turned back to Los Angeles International Airport after a report of an engine fire. It landed safely at 11:29 a.m., 256 passengers and 12 crew evacuated with no injuries, and firefighters monitored the engine as a ground stop was lifted and travelers were bused to the terminals.
